ELECTROMAGNETIC COMPATIBILITY -WITHOUT EQUATIONS

This book deals with practical concepts of Electromagnetic Compatibility testing and design. Given the scorching pace at which electronic gadgets are evolving, deadlines associated with product design are shrinking rapidly. In such a scenario, the designer obviously has no time to read mathematical theory. Keeping this fact in mind, the book explains only the practical aspects of EMC design without resorting to equations or mathematical derivations whatsoever. It has been designed in such a way that the designer can immediately incorporate EMC measures without worrying about the mathematics behind it. The book starts with EMC fundamentals, speaks about EMC standards and then goes on to explain various EMC test methodologies in detail. In the subsequent chapters, various design measures like filtering, shielding, grounding & bonding, PCB design and cable routing are discussed thoroughly. These measures will enable manufacturers to design a compliant product at the design stage itself thereby saving time and money that would otherwise be required for costly retrofits once the design is frozen.

Electromagnetic Compatibility

This book highlights principles and applications of electromagnetic compatibility (EMC). After introducing the basic concepts, research progress, standardizations and limitations of EMC, the book puts emphasis on presenting the generation mechanisms and suppression principles of conducted electromagnetic interference (EMI) noise, radiated EMI noise, and electromagnetic susceptibility (EMS) problems such as electrostatic discharge (ESD), electric fast transient (EFT) and surge. By showing EMC case studies and solved examples, the book provides effective solutions to practical engineering problems. Students and researchers will be able to use the book as practical reference for EMC-related measurements and problem- solution.

Electromagnetic Compatibility

The issue of electromagnetic compatibility has become increasingly important due to the widespread use of electronics in functions requiring very high degrees of reliability. Examples range from aircraft and spacecraft to the braking systems of modern cars. These electronic systems must withstand potential damage inflicted by both natural disturbances (such as lightning) and man-made disturbances (such as nuclear electromagnetic pulses, radar, and industrial power converters). This book describes interference sources and associated radiated fields and considers modes of coupling between the disturbance and the system in question on qualitative and quantitative levels. The book also outlines simulation and test procedures necessary to develop protective techniques. Electromagnetic Compatibility is an informative and practical book which describes the basics of electromagnetic compatibility. It will be valuable to practicing electrical and electronic engineers, and is also appropriate for use in introductory academic courses.

Electromagnetic Compatibility in Medical Equipment

"Co-published by IEEE Press and Interpharm Press, Electromagnetic Compatibility in Medical Equipment is a practical, hands-on guide to EMC issues for medical device designers and installers. The book addresses electromagnetic interference and covers the basics of EMC design, physics, and installation, minimizing theory and concentrating upon the correct way to ground and shield." "Twelve detailed chapters cover EMC from the inside out, beginning with the basics of electronics. Problems and common causes are discussed and evaluated. Effective remedial techniques are explored at three levels - circuit, box, and interconnect. The book also contains several useful appendices that provide important reference material including key information resources to EMC publications, materials (e.g., common metals and shielding materials), and constant and conversion factors."
